Role Overview
Lead and manage IT operations and the technical team delivering computer operations and support services. Oversee daily activities including project scheduling incident response team development and continuous improvement initiatives to enhance service delivery and customer sat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ities
-
Manage and coordinate daily activities of the technical team including project scheduling monitoring and incident response.
-
Ensure operational support coverage and adherence to service level agreements (SLAs).
-
Monitor system performance and availability ensuring timely resolution of issues.
-
Develop implement and maintain operational standards procedures and best practices.
-
Ensure compliance with internal policies industry standards and regulatory requirements.
-
Plan and manage the integration and support of new technologies into the operational environment.
-
Collaborate with infrastructure and application teams to ensure seamless deployment and support of systems.
-
Lead mentor and develop a team of supervisors project leaders and technical staff.
-
Conduct performance evaluations training and succession planning.
-
Provide input on business continuity planning and disaster recovery strategies.
-
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ance service delivery and customer satisfaction.
-
Oversee the deployment configuration and lifecycle management of IT assets including desktops laptops mobile devices printers and servers.
-
Develop and implement IT service management processes: incident problem change and request management.
-
Coordinate and support enterprise-wide software rollouts updates and patch management activities.
-
Monitor and improve service desk performance timely resolution of user issues and high customer satisfaction.
